黑狐家游戏

大数据处理的四个主要流程用哪些软件,大数据处理的四个主要流程用哪些软件,揭秘大数据处理四大流程,精选软件助力高效分析

欧气 0 0
大数据处理四大流程涉及数据采集、存储、处理和分析。主要软件包括Hadoop、Spark、Flink、HBase、Kafka等,它们助力高效数据分析,助力企业挖掘数据价值。

本文目录导读:

  1. 数据采集
  2. 数据存储
  3. 数据处理
  4. 数据挖掘与分析

数据采集

数据采集是大数据处理的第一步,它涉及到从各种来源获取原始数据,以下是几种常用的数据采集软件:

大数据处理的四个主要流程用哪些软件,大数据处理的四个主要流程用哪些软件,揭秘大数据处理四大流程,精选软件助力高效分析

图片来源于网络,如有侵权联系删除

1、Apache Flume:Apache Flume是一个分布式、可靠、高效的日志收集系统,用于收集、聚合、移动和存储大量日志数据。

2、Apache Kafka:Apache Kafka是一个分布式流处理平台,用于构建实时数据管道和流应用程序,它具有高吞吐量、可扩展性和容错性等特点。

3、Apache NiFi:Apache NiFi是一个易于使用的、基于流的系统,用于自动化、监控和控制数据流,它可以帮助用户轻松地实现数据采集、转换和传输。

数据存储

数据存储是大数据处理的核心环节,以下是一些常用的数据存储软件:

1、Hadoop HDFS:Hadoop HDFS是一个分布式文件系统,用于存储大量数据,它具有高可靠性、容错性和可扩展性等特点。

2、Apache Cassandra:Apache Cassandra是一个分布式、无中心的数据存储系统,适用于大规模数据集,它具有高性能、可扩展性和容错性等特点。

大数据处理的四个主要流程用哪些软件,大数据处理的四个主要流程用哪些软件,揭秘大数据处理四大流程,精选软件助力高效分析

图片来源于网络,如有侵权联系删除

3、MongoDB:MongoDB是一个高性能、可扩展的文档存储数据库,适用于处理非结构化和半结构化数据。

数据处理

数据处理是大数据处理的关键环节,以下是一些常用的数据处理软件:

1、Apache Spark:Apache Spark是一个分布式计算系统,用于处理大规模数据集,它具有高吞吐量、容错性和易用性等特点。

2、Apache Hadoop MapReduce:Apache Hadoop MapReduce是一种编程模型,用于大规模数据处理,它将计算任务分解成多个并行执行的任务,提高处理效率。

3、Apache Hive:Apache Hive是一个基于Hadoop的数据仓库工具,用于处理大规模数据集,它提供了一种类似于SQL的查询语言,方便用户进行数据查询和分析。

数据挖掘与分析

数据挖掘与分析是大数据处理的最终目标,以下是一些常用的数据挖掘与分析软件:

大数据处理的四个主要流程用哪些软件,大数据处理的四个主要流程用哪些软件,揭秘大数据处理四大流程,精选软件助力高效分析

图片来源于网络,如有侵权联系删除

1、Apache Mahout:Apache Mahout是一个可扩展的机器学习库,提供多种机器学习算法,它可以帮助用户从大量数据中提取有价值的信息。

2、R语言:R语言是一种统计计算和图形工具,广泛应用于数据挖掘和分析领域,它具有丰富的库和函数,可以满足用户的各种需求。

3、Python:Python是一种通用编程语言,具有强大的数据处理和分析能力,它拥有许多优秀的库,如NumPy、Pandas、Scikit-learn等,可以方便地实现数据挖掘与分析。

大数据处理是一个复杂的过程,涉及到数据采集、存储、处理和分析等多个环节,通过使用上述软件,我们可以提高大数据处理效率,为企业和组织提供有价值的数据分析结果,在实际应用中,根据具体需求和场景,选择合适的软件组合,才能实现高效的大数据处理。

标签: #大数据处理软件 #高效分析工具

黑狐家游戏
  • 评论列表

留言评论